The 18th Parliament of Ibagli is likely to begin in the Spring of 2017. Members of the House of Commons were elected in the general election that was held on 21 September 2017.
A royal commission is expected to convene the House of Commons on the morning of 9 October. The House will then elect a speaker. The Governor-General will then open the first session of the 17th Parliament that afternoon.
Election of the Speaker
As the incumbent speaker, Sir Brian Rodney, stood down from Parliament at the 2017 election, there will be an open election at the beginning of a Parliament for the first time since 1999. Election of the Speaker of the House of Commons is by successive secret ballots, with candidates receiving fewer than three votes or, if all candidates receive three or more votes, the candidate receiving the fewest votes being eliminated in each round, until a candidate receives a majority of votes cast. The following members-elect have announced their intention to stand for election:
- Vincent Craddock (Conservative)
- Kendrick Matusiak (Conservative)
- Vincent Mott (Liberal)
